Join our team as a skilled HGV Driver, responsible for safely delivering and collecting equipment across Ireland under the guidance of the Transport Manager.
Responsibilities:
- Drive HGVs to transport equipment, including loading and unloading at customer sites.
- Conduct pre- and post-inspections to ensure safety and compliance.
- Secure loads properly, adhering to safety standards.
- Communicate effectively with the transport team and customers.
- Complete documentation accurately and promptly.
Requirements:
- Valid HGV Category CE Licence
- Relevant experience
- Strong communication skills
- Flexibility to work evenings and weekends
Additional Details:
The role is based in Cookstown, offering a competitive salary from £15.25 per hour, with overtime pay, benefits, and a full-time permanent position. Hours are Monday to Friday, with opportunities for career growth. We value positivity, responsibility, integrity, determination, and energy.
